程序员|程序员必知的python之禅,助你事倍功半!

【程序员|程序员必知的python之禅,助你事倍功半!】程序员|程序员必知的python之禅,助你事倍功半!

大家好 , 到了高度计算机化的今天 , 程序员不断增多 。 那么并非是有程序员都知道这些事情 。 这些事情是很著名的程序员提出的 。 小编觉得所有程序猿应该要非常了解 , 这些 。 并且要烂熟于心 。
那么做其他工作的人也可以 。 跟着小编了解一下 。 因为这些定律可能会影响到你的工作 。 提高工作效率 。 那么这是非常宝贵的几个经验 。 希望大家可以看一看 。 好了 。 下面跟随着小编一起来了解一下吧!
那么第一个众所周知 。
程序员笃信代码可以编写得漂亮而优雅 。 编程是要解决问题的 , 设计良好 , 高效而漂亮的解决黎称会让程序员心生敬意 。 随着你对yon的认识越来越深人 , 并使用它来编写越来态的的代码 。有一天也许会有人站在你后面惊呼:“哇 , 代码编写得真是课亮!”

Simple is better than complex.
如果有两个解决方案 , 一个简单 , 一个复杂 , 但都行之有效 , 就选择简单的解决方案吧 。 这样 , 你编写的代码将更容易维护 , 你或他人以后改进这些代码时也会更容易 。
Complex is better than complicated.
现实是复杂的 , 有时候可能没有简单的解决方案 。 在这种情况下 , 就选择最简单可行的解决方案吧 。
Readability counts.
即便是复杂的代码 , 也要让它易于理解 。 开发的项目涉及复杂代码时 , -定要为这些代码编写有益的注释 。
There should be one-- and preferably only one --obvious way to do it.
如果让两名Python程序员去解决同一个问题 , 他们提供的解决方案应大致相同 。 这并不是说编程没有创意空间 , 而是恰恰相反!然而 , 大部分编程工作都是使用常见解决方案来解决简单的小问题 , 但这些小问题都包含在更庞大、更有创意空间的项目中 。 在你的程序中 , 各种具体细节对其他Python程序员来说都应易于理解 。
Now is better than never .
好了 这就是今天给您分享的全部内容了 , 如果觉得收获了很多 , 不妨试试关注我们 每天一个社交技巧 助您轻松实现梦想 。
内容选自《python编程从入门到精通》书籍如有侵权请联系作者及时删除 。


    推荐阅读